This year at Mount View Elementary School in Thorndike, Maine, Principal Alicia McCormick and her staff have made equity and cultural responsiveness a high priority. In collaboration with teacher Christina Hall, Mrs. McCormick shares a daily cultural fact with all students during morning announcements. Each month a different cultural heritage is highlighted in and around a “Culture Corner” bulletin board, at the entrance of MVES, maintained by Ms. Hall. Additionally, students are learning about the historical achievements of people from many different cultures, to broaden students’ understanding that role models exist in all cultures. We are committed to providing our students with “mirrors” and “windows”into our multicultural world.
